On Fri, Dec 17, 2021 at 10:21:04AM +0100, Peter Eisentraut wrote: > On 16.12.21 07:50, Michael Paquier wrote: > > As per $subject, avoiding the flush of the new cluster's data > > directory shortens a bint the runtime of the test. In some of my slow > > VMs, aka Windows, this shaves a couple of seconds even if the bulk of > > the time is still spent on the main regression test suite. > > > > In pg_upgrade, we let the flush happen with initdb --sync-only, based > > on the binary path of the new cluster, so I think that we are not > > going to miss any test coverage by skipping that. > > I think that is reasonable. > > Maybe we could have some global option, like some environment variable, that > enables the "sync" mode in all tests, so it's easy to test that once in a > while. Not really a requirement for your patch, but an idea in case this is > a concern.
